The investment seeks maximum long-term capital growth. The fund invests primarily in developed markets but also may invest up to 35% of the fund's total assets at market value at the time of purchase in emerging and less developed markets. Under normal market conditions, it is substantially fully invested in common stocks and similar securities, and invests at least 65% of its net assets at market value at the time of purchase in securities of non-U.S. companies.
